This paper describes datamanager and database facilities designed to support a computer-aided electronic design system. Datamanager facilities are those for managing files without regard to their contents; database facilities are those for managing the contents of files. Taken together, these facilities provide transparent and user- controlled services for managing the considerable amounts of information which can be generated in CAD environments.
